Home care services in Lancashire provide essential support for individuals who wish to remain safe, comfortable, and independent in their own home rather than moving into a residential care facility. Professional care at home can include personal care, companionship, medication support, meal preparation, dementia care, and full live-in care services tailored to individual needs.
According to the NHS guide to social care and support, home care services can help individuals maintain independence and improve quality of life while receiving professional support in familiar surroundings.
Types of Home Care Services in Lancashire
There are several types of home care services available across Lancashire to support varying care requirements, including:
- Personal care assistance
- Medication reminders and support
- Meal preparation
- Domestic and housekeeping support
- Companionship care
- Dementia care
- Respite care for families
- Live-in care services

Importance of Companionship Care
Companionship care is an important aspect of home care services because emotional well-being is just as important as physical support. A compassionate caregiver can provide meaningful social interaction, conversation, and emotional reassurance that helps reduce loneliness and isolation.
Activities may include:
- Walks and light exercise
- Reading and games
- Gardening
- Social outings
- Conversation and emotional support
This type of care helps individuals remain active, engaged, and confident while continuing to live independently at home.
Live-In Care in Lancashire

What is Live-In Care?
Live-in care provides continuous one-to-one support from a dedicated caregiver who stays in the client’s home. This allows individuals to receive round-the-clock assistance while remaining in familiar surroundings.
Live-in care is ideal for people who require ongoing support with:
- Personal care
- Mobility assistance
- Medication management
- Meal preparation
- Overnight supervision
- Companionship
Benefits of Live-In Care at Home
Choosing live-in care in Lancashire offers several benefits:
- Staying in a familiar environment
- Maintaining independence and routines
- Receiving personalised care
- Improved emotional well-being
- Enhanced safety and reassurance
- Flexible support as care needs change
For many families, live-in care provides peace of mind while ensuring loved ones receive compassionate and professional support.

Quality Assurance in Home Care
The Care Quality Commission (CQC) regulates home care providers to ensure safe and effective care services. You can learn more about care standards through the Care Quality Commission (CQC).
Choosing a regulated provider gives families confidence that their loved one is receiving professional and compassionate support.
